As promised, here are the results of last night's match vs. Tierp. It was basically a must-win match for us in order to go to the Grand Prix (a tournament right after New Years for the top four teams). Apparently the Grand Prix is a VERY big deal, the biggest thing in volleyball in Sweden - more important than the actual championship. With our backs to the wall, we came out ready to play good, focused volleyball - and Vingaker prevailed!
We took the match in 3 straight sets 25-23, 25-17, 25-19 in just 61 minutes. We played great, well-rounded volleyball, with contributions from everyone. I lead the team with 12 points on 10 kills and 2 blocks. Tobi and Dave followed up with 7 points each.
